Becky is 16 years old and wants to find her Target Heart Rate for vigorous-intensity physical activity. She finds her MHR to be
sashaice [31]

Answer:

Becky’s THR would be between 157 bpm and 190 bpm during the physical activity.

Explanation:

From the given information;

Since Becky is 16 years old, in order to evaluate the MHR, we deduct the age from 220.

Therefore, the evaluation of the maximum age-related heart rate MHR = 220 - 16 = 204 beats per minute

We are being told that she then multiplies her MHR by 77% and 93%.

i.e

77% level: 204 × 0.77 = 157 bpm

93% level : 204 × 0.93 = 190 bpm

The evaluation indicates that the vigorous-intensity physical activity of Becky at 16 years old will need the target heart rate to remain between 157 bpm and 190 bpm during the physical activity.
